Preventative dentistry

The 2 major dental diseases, dental caries (tooth decay) and Chronic Inflammatory Periodontal Disease (CIPD), commonly known as pyorrhea are preventable diseases, hence our surgery promotes preventive and early treatment. We encourage regular dental check-ups based on patient needs, not on a hard and fast rule of every 6 months. Patients who are unable to maintain good oral hygiene to control CIPD may need bi- or tri- monthly maintenance check-ups whereas others with excellent oral hygiene may only need yearly, 2-yearly or even 3-yearly check-ups.

Besides prophylaxis, preventive dentistry may also include dietary advice, instructions in effective tooth brushing techniques, flossing and other interdental cleaning procedures, special oral hygiene procedures for patients with braces, implants, dental crown and bridge works, topical fluoride applications, fissure sealing, treatment of dental hypersensitivity, and interceptive orthodontic treatment.

Prosthetic Dentistry
Denture/removable prosthesis are cheaper forms of replacing missing teeth. Very often poor retention and stability of full dentures are the cause of masticatory difficulty in full denture wearers; especially after many years of wearing full dentures resulting in markedly resorbed (flattened) alveolar ridges. Where indicated, implants can be used to enhance denture retention and/or support.

Periodontics

Chronic Inflammatory Periodontal Disease (CIPD) is the most common disease affecting the adult population. Most sufferers are unaware of this problem because the abnormal (>80%) has become the norm (<20%)

Since supporting alveolar bone once loss, does not regrow, early treatment is essential and will prevent unnecessary tooth loss due to CIPD.

Sufferers of CIPD will need to undergo a course of preliminary periodontal treatment followed by definitive periodontal surgery if indicated.
